Elsevier Logo

Elsevier

Senior Software Engineer (Python/AWS)

Job Posted 5 Days Ago Posted 5 Days Ago
Be an Early Applicant
Chennai, Tamil Nadu
Senior level
Chennai, Tamil Nadu
Senior level
The Senior Software Engineer will design, develop, and deliver software solutions, mentor team members, and support continuous improvement practices while working in an Agile environment.
The summary above was generated by AI

Senior Software Engineer (Python/AWS)  

Are you interested in seeing real products and systems come to life with your software?  

Do you enjoy collaborating with your team members to deliver important and critical improvements that make a difference? 

About Our Team 

Our Technology teams use contemporary technologies to develop products and systems that support science and health. We provide customers with robust digital solutions that aid in researching significant global issues. Our culture emphasizes efficient DevOps practices, focusing on speed, agility, cost efficiency, and high quality. 

About the Role 

As a Senior Software Engineer II, you will be a key part of our Agile squad and an advocate for best-practice coding. You will build solutions that will help support Elsevier’s goals of helping researchers and healthcare professionals advance science and improve health outcomes for the benefit of society through the on-time delivery of high-quality software products.  

Responsibilities 

  • Designing, developing, and delivering software across our Enterprise Product Hub estate using a variety of technologies and tools 

  • Working closely with the Product team to design and develop application features and data integrations supported by a Python/microservice-driven architecture 

  • Ensuring well-tested, documented code is written by encouraging best practices and applying software engineering principles 

  • Collaborating with cross-functional technical teams to deliver successful, high-profile, business-critical projects in a fast-paced environment 

  • Mentoring and guiding team members to develop their skills in software development and best practices 

  • Contributing to continuous improvement within the standards and processes for ongoing development 

  • Interfacing with other technical personnel or team members to finalize requirements 

  • Writing and reviewing portions of detailed specifications for the development of system components 

  • Working closely with other development team members to understand product requirements and translate them into software designs 

  • Successfully implementing development processes, coding best practices, and code reviews through your understanding of software development methodologies 

  • Practicing Agile development – including the use of Jira, Continuous Integration, and Continuous Delivery 

Requirements 

  • 5+ years of Software Engineering experience 

  • Experience equivalent to a BS in Engineering/Computer Science or other relevant field 

  • Proven background and experience in a senior software engineering role 

  • Advanced proficiency in Python programming language and frameworks such as PySpark 

  • Advanced proficiency in Structured Query Language (SQL) 

  • Experience with Cloud Computing Platforms, preferably AWS 

  • Experience with Continuous Integration and Continuous Delivery build pipelines using tools like Jenkins and GIT in an Agile environment 

  • Strong analytical and problem-solving skills with the ability to collect, organize, analyze, and disseminate significant amounts of information 

  • Collaborative working style and enthusiasm for mentoring and supporting team members 

Work in a Way that Works for You 

We promote a healthy work/life balance across the organization. We offer numerous well-being initiatives, shared parental leave, study assistance, and sabbaticals to help you meet both your immediate responsibilities and long-term goals. 

Working for You 

We understand that your well-being and happiness are essential to a successful career. Here are some benefits we offer: 

  • Comprehensive Health Insurance covering you, your immediate family, and parents 

  • Enhanced Health Insurance Options with competitive rates 

  • Group Life Insurance ensuring financial security for your loved ones 

  • Group Accident Insurance offering extra protection 

  • Flexible Working Arrangements to achieve a balanced work-life schedule 

  • Employee Assistance Program providing support for personal and work-related challenges 

  • Medical Screening prioritizes your well-being 

  • Modern Family Benefits include parental and adoption support 

  • Long-Service Awards recognize dedication and commitment 

  • Celebratory New Baby Gift 

  • Subsidized Meals in Chennai 

  • Various Paid Time Off options including Casual Leave, Sick Leave, Privilege Leave, Compassionate Leave, Special Sick Leave, and Gazetted Public Holidays 

  • Free Transport for home-office-home commutes in Chennai 

About the Business 

We are a global leader in information and analytics, assisting researchers and healthcare professionals in advancing science and improving health outcomes for society's benefit. Leveraging our publishing heritage, we combine quality information and extensive data sets with analytics to support visionary science and research, health education, and interactive learning. At Elsevier, your work contributes to addressing the world's grand challenges and fostering a sustainable future. We utilize innovative technologies to support science and healthcare, partnering for a better world. 

#LI-JR1

#LI-Hybrid

-----------------------------------------------------------------------

Elsevier is an equal opportunity employer: qualified applicants are considered for and treated during employment without regard to race, color, creed, religion, sex, national origin, citizenship status, disability status, protected veteran status, age, marital status, sexual orientation, gender identity, genetic information, or any other characteristic protected by law. We are committed to providing a fair and accessible hiring process. If you have a disability or other need that requires accommodation or adjustment, please let us know by completing our Applicant Request Support Form: https://forms.office.com/r/eVgFxjLmAK , or please contact 1-855-833-5120.

Please read our Candidate Privacy Policy.

Top Skills

AWS
Git
Jenkins
Python
SQL

Similar Jobs

2 Hours Ago
Hybrid
Chennai, Tamil Nadu, IND
Senior level
Senior level
Big Data • Fintech • Information Technology • Business Intelligence • Financial Services • Cybersecurity • Big Data Analytics
The Senior Developer will lead the Marketing Solution's Engineering team by developing multilayered microservices Java applications for cloud deployment, providing marketing solutions to clients.
Top Skills: AWSBitbucketGitlabGCPIntellijMavenMySQLNode.jsPostgresPythonVisual Studio
Yesterday
Hybrid
Chennai, Tamil Nadu, IND
Expert/Leader
Expert/Leader
Agency • Digital Media • eCommerce • Professional Services • Software • Analytics • Consulting
Lead the design and implementation of comprehensive test strategies, drive QA initiatives, and advocate for testing best practices while ensuring the highest quality standards across platforms.
Top Skills: AppiumAWSAzureAzure DevopsBrowserstackCypressGitlabJavaJavaScriptJenkinsPlaywrightPostmanPythonRestassuredSeleniumSwagger
Yesterday
Hybrid
Chennai, Tamil Nadu, IND
Senior level
Senior level
Agency • Digital Media • eCommerce • Professional Services • Software • Analytics • Consulting
As a Full Stack Technical Architect, you will design and implement technology solutions, mentor teams, and ensure alignment with business goals across various sectors.
Top Skills: AngularApi GatewayAWSAzureGCPGraphQLJavaKafkaNode.jsSpring BootTypescript

What you need to know about the Bengaluru Tech Scene

Dubbed the "Silicon Valley of India," Bengaluru has emerged as the nation's leading hub for information technology and a go-to destination for startups. Home to tech giants like ISRO, Infosys, Wipro and HAL, the city attracts and cultivates a rich pool of tech talent, supported by numerous educational and research institutions including the Indian Institute of Science, Bangalore Institute of Technology, and the International Institute of Information Technology.
By clicking Apply you agree to share your profile information with the hiring company.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account